Why Driveway Paving Matters in New Jersey

Let’s be real: New Jersey weather isn’t always kind. Between the freezing winters, heavy rain in the spring, and scorching summers, our driveways take a serious beating. Over time, cracks, potholes, and crumbling edges aren’t just an eyesore — they can lead to bigger, more expensive problems.

Potential buyers here notice these things immediately. According to Zillow, homes with high curb appeal sell for 7% more on average than similar homes with a less inviting exterior. And what’s front and center when someone pulls up to your house? Yup — your driveway.

If you live in towns like Rockaway, Randolph, or Budd Lake, you already know how competitive the real estate market can get. Investing in a quality driveway paving job could mean the difference between a quick, top-dollar sale and months of waiting with price cuts.

Practical Benefits That Matter to Buyers

A good driveway isn’t just about looks. It’s also about functionality and safety — two things NJ buyers prioritize. Here’s how:

  • Durability: A professionally paved asphalt driveway can last 20-30 years with proper maintenance. That’s a huge selling point.

  • Reduced Maintenance: Modern materials and sealcoating options mean fewer repairs down the road.

  • Safety: No one wants to trip over a pothole or twist an ankle in a cracked driveway. A smooth surface means peace of mind, especially for families with kids or elderly relatives.

When buyers are touring homes, they’re subconsciously checking for “hidden costs.” Seeing a brand-new driveway can reassure them that they won’t have to shell out big bucks after moving in.

Timing is Everything: When to Pave in NJ

If you’re considering paving, spring through early fall is prime time. You want warm, dry conditions for the asphalt to cure properly.

Scheduling early also helps you beat the last-minute fall rush when homeowners scramble to get projects done before winter hits. (Trust us — we’ve had our phones ringing off the hook around October in towns like Long Valley and Hackettstown.)

Practical Tips for Homeowners Thinking About Paving

If you’re considering upgrading your driveway, here are a few quick tips:

  • Choose the right material: Asphalt is king in NJ because it handles freeze-thaw cycles better than concrete.

  • Think long-term: A little extra investment in better drainage or thicker asphalt layers now saves major headaches later.

  • Seal the deal: Regular sealcoating (every 2-3 years) protects your investment and keeps it looking brand new.
